Nvidia GeForce 3D Vision Kit review

Nvidia GeForce 3D Vision Kit review

Aiming to give your games the appearance of running in full 3D, the effect produced by the GeForce 3D Vision Kit is certainly impressive, even if it doesn't work equally well for all compatible games. We didn't find it suitable for protracted use, but it should suit casual gamers well Read more

Samsung YP-U5 review

Samsung YP-U5 review

Those seeking an affordable secondary MP3 player could do far worse than the YP-U5. Its battery life is good, it offers above-average sound quality and it supports a decent range of audio formats, although AAC is notably missing. A fitness app also makes it well-suited to gym fanatics Read more

Devolo dLAN 200 AVdesk Starter Kit review

Devolo dLAN 200 AVdesk Starter Kit review

Aimed primarily at those daunted by the prospect of setting up an ordinary wired home network, the Devolo dLAN 200 AVdesk Starter Kit simply plugs into into electical plug sockets and streams files over your power cables. It's secure and easy to setup, but it doesn't achieve its manufacturer's performance claims Read more

Nike + iPod Sport Kit review

Nike + iPod Sport Kit review

The Nike + iPod Sport Kit is a simple and effective way of turning your iPod nano into a sophisticated pedometer. The kit consists of three parts -- the transmitter, the receiver and the shoe itself (a Nike, of course). If you're looking for a personal trainer without the bank-busting price tag, look no further Read more

Olympus Evolt E-330 camera kit review

Olympus Evolt E-330 camera kit review

Kodak used two sensors in its EasyShare V570 to enable its ultrawide second lens. Olympus puts a second sensor to better use with its Evolt E-330 -- providing its digital SLR with a useful live preview, just like those in standard point-and-shoot cameras Read more
